Milo Manara’s (originally Il gioco) is a foundational work of erotic comics, first published in 1983. It centers on Claudia Cristiani, an elegant but sexually repressed woman who becomes the subject of a scientific experiment involving a brain implant controlled by a remote device.   • The "Ligne Claire" Style: Manara employs a style reminiscent of the French-Belgian tradition (similar to Hergé’s Tintin), characterized by clear, strong outlines and flat colors. This clean, innocent aesthetic creates a striking juxtaposition with the explicit, hardcore content of the narrative. This contrast prevents the work from looking gritty or obscene, instead lending it an air of sophisticated fantasy.
  • Anatomy and Motion: Manara is celebrated for his ability to draw the female form. His characters are noted for their anatomical plausibility and elasticity. He excels at depicting physical movement—specifically the contortions and postures of sexual acts—with a fluidity that makes them appear graceful rather than awkward.
  • Facial Expressions: A key strength in Click is the depiction of Claudia’s facial expressions. Manara captures the subtle shifts between haughty disdain (her initial state) and ecstatic abandon (her awakened state), driving the character development visually without the need for excessive dialogue.
